Welcome to a Pasture House – a stunning East Yorkshire holiday house with five star amenities and a homely Manor House feel. With six stunning bedrooms, one being on the ground floor and wheelchair friendly, hot tubs and stunning outdoor space, it’s the perfect place to bring your group for an idyllic rural stay with plenty of fun on the doorstep and the coast ten minutes away.
The kitchen at Pasture House is a beautiful, sociable hub. With sleek grey units, pale quartz worktops, and top-of-the-range appliances, it’s fully equipped welcome and cater for your group with effortless style. Gather around the central island for casual breakfasts, whip up family feasts or picnics at lunchtime and chill by the log burner as dinner simmers after a long day of exploring. The Sun Room offers a special dining experience with its high ceiling, feature lighting, and doors opening directly onto the garden. Whether you’re rustling up a gourmet banquet or enjoying wood-fired pizza outside, every mealtime here becomes a shared experience.
With six beautifully designed bedrooms, Pasture House sleeps up to 12 guests. Each room is ensuite and can be set up as either a super-king or twin, offering flexibility for families or friends to share comfortably as a group. Thoughtful touches like plush linens, large mirrors, dressing tables, and elegant furnishings create a luxury hotel feel with the added privacy of your own home. Every room has its own style and colour palette, so you can choose your favourite and settle in instantly. The Ground Floor bedroom is wheelchair friendly with its own tv and ensuite shower with seat and grab rails.
Designed for togetherness and tranquillity, there’s plenty of space for everyone to relax and unwind. The large, light-filled living room has Chesterfield sofas, a cosy log burner, and beautiful countryside views. There’s a stylish bar area, which is perfect for pre-dinner drinks and post-dinner socialising, while outside, the private garden invites lazy afternoons and al fresco fun. Soak in one of two large hot tubs, fire up the barbecue or pizza oven, or stretch out on a sun lounger with a good book – there’s never any rush here!
Surrounded by peaceful East Yorkshire farmland within ten minutes of the coast, Pasture House is ideal for countryside adventures. Step out into your spacious, enclosed garden or follow nearby walking and cycling routes straight from the doorstep. The charming villages and market towns of the Yorkshire Wolds are close by, as are the wide beaches of the East Coast. Explore Beverley’s historic streets, visit seaside favourites like Bridlington or Hornsea, or discover hidden gems in the countryside. Then return to the comfort of the house to watch the sunset from the garden or stargaze from the hot tubs.
By Road
Brandesburton is just off the A165 between Hull and Bridlington. From Hull, it takes about 30 minutes. From York or Leeds, follow signs to Beverley, then take the A1035 towards Brandesburton. Free parking is available at both Pasture House and The Stables.
By Train
The closest stations are:
Beverley – 20 minutes by car
Hull – 30 minutes by car
Both have taxi services and regular trains from major cities like York, Leeds, and London.
By Air
Nearby airports include:
Humberside Airport – 45 minutes by car
Leeds Bradford – about 1.5 hours away
Car hire and taxis are available at all airports.
